Iraqis storm London embassy
The Iraqi embassy in London has been stormed by a group of men celebrating Saddam Hussein's downfall.
Up to 24 men, believed to be Iraqis, smashed their way into the building in Kensington.
It is believed that Iraqi officials share premises with the Jordanian Embassy.
Members of the public alerted police about the raid at 2.30pm.
A Scotland Yard spokeswoman said: "Twenty-four people had forced entry, 18 people have been arrested for criminal damage and associated offences. They have been taken to a central London police station."
Police remain at the scene.
The spokeswoman, who could not comment on damage or what weapons had been used, said: "The area has been contained. There certainly does not appear to be any crowd problems."
